Businesses with customized operations grow to become profitable within the shortest time. The process of developing such apps is not as easy as it sounds. It requires partnership with the right Custom Software Development Baton Rouge Lafayette New Orleans LA partner. This means a company with the expertise, commitment and passion. How do you find the company or partner?
Begin by understanding the end product. This means what you would like the app to do for your business. Have an image of how it would appear and the reception it would get from your clientele. Think of a marketing strategy and how well it suits your partners, associates, employees and other connected service providers. This will lead to a sketch that will assist you in explaining the idea to a developer.
Be ready for numerous questions on your operations and business from the developer. The interrogation is aimed at helping him understand your needs. The questions revolve around linkages between departments, associates, work flow, etc. This is helpful in configuring the app to ensure that it serves the intended purpose. It will enable the developer to configure a realistic app.
Over-promising developers should not be trusted. Their promises are usually too-good-to-be-believe. Others just keep quiet and do not interrogate your idea. As experts, they need to challenge your idea with the aim of understanding and modifying it. In the absence of a challenge and where the promises are overly unbelievable, you need to be cautious. You could be dealing with an amateur.
Get quotations from more than one developer. Where possible, you may break down the app into different segments. Get a quantified quotation for each process. A developer who presents a general figure should be treated with caution. With a detailed quotation, you can identify areas where you are getting better value from another developer. This also helps you to know the market rates for such services.
Team players will offer better value. Applications are used continuously, require maintenance and upgrades. As such, any proposal where the seller will disappear after sale should be rejected. In fact, expert developers propose to incorporate your IT team in the development process. With a long term contract, your initial expenditure will be reduced in favor of a long term contract.
Because of the complexity of technology, maintain your focus on how the app will operate. You might not understand the technical terms used. However, when you include your expectations in the contract, you can put the developer to task in case they are not delivered. Work with leaders in IT who have a reputation and track record of quality work.
Software development is an expensive affair. Be ready to pay the price in order to get a quality app. Insist on a long term contract for the purposes of maintenance, upgrades, etc. With a quality product, you are guaranteed value for money. Negotiate the price but do not allow any compromise on quality. Remember that long term success depends on the commitment and expertise of the developer.
Begin by understanding the end product. This means what you would like the app to do for your business. Have an image of how it would appear and the reception it would get from your clientele. Think of a marketing strategy and how well it suits your partners, associates, employees and other connected service providers. This will lead to a sketch that will assist you in explaining the idea to a developer.
Be ready for numerous questions on your operations and business from the developer. The interrogation is aimed at helping him understand your needs. The questions revolve around linkages between departments, associates, work flow, etc. This is helpful in configuring the app to ensure that it serves the intended purpose. It will enable the developer to configure a realistic app.
Over-promising developers should not be trusted. Their promises are usually too-good-to-be-believe. Others just keep quiet and do not interrogate your idea. As experts, they need to challenge your idea with the aim of understanding and modifying it. In the absence of a challenge and where the promises are overly unbelievable, you need to be cautious. You could be dealing with an amateur.
Get quotations from more than one developer. Where possible, you may break down the app into different segments. Get a quantified quotation for each process. A developer who presents a general figure should be treated with caution. With a detailed quotation, you can identify areas where you are getting better value from another developer. This also helps you to know the market rates for such services.
Team players will offer better value. Applications are used continuously, require maintenance and upgrades. As such, any proposal where the seller will disappear after sale should be rejected. In fact, expert developers propose to incorporate your IT team in the development process. With a long term contract, your initial expenditure will be reduced in favor of a long term contract.
Because of the complexity of technology, maintain your focus on how the app will operate. You might not understand the technical terms used. However, when you include your expectations in the contract, you can put the developer to task in case they are not delivered. Work with leaders in IT who have a reputation and track record of quality work.
Software development is an expensive affair. Be ready to pay the price in order to get a quality app. Insist on a long term contract for the purposes of maintenance, upgrades, etc. With a quality product, you are guaranteed value for money. Negotiate the price but do not allow any compromise on quality. Remember that long term success depends on the commitment and expertise of the developer.
About the Author:
Check out cyberfision.com for a summary of the benefits of using custom software development Baton Rouge services, today. You can also get more info about an experienced software developer at http://www.cyberfision.com/custom-software-development now.
No comments:
Post a Comment